The Koch Ness Monster Supreme is the culmination of a 15-year-long relationship between the legendary ‪@GregKochMusic‬ and JAM pedals, built on mutual love, admiration and respect for each other's work.
We embarked on a mission to craft the ultimate pedalboards that meet Greg's every need-whether he's rocking out live, recording in the studio, or diving deep into his creative process.
The Koch Ness Monster Supreme is designed after Greg's wildest pedal dreams.
Equipped with an armada of flavours perfectly complementing one another, this battleship of a multi pedal poses as the ultimate effect assortment, crafted to inspire and embellish Greg's musical process.
Working closely with Greg to make the Koch Ness Monster Supreme a reality, led to a number of unique and innovative features:
- We included Greg's signature Gristle King Overdrive
- We included a second delay unit in the form of the Delay Llama mk.2 which Greg uses as an always-on slapback
- The Delay Llama XTREME and Harmonious Monk come preloaded with Greg's custom presets
- You can sync the Delay Llama XTREME's Tap Tempo to the Harmonious Monk allowing you to control both units with a single Tap
The Signal Chain is:
1. Wahcko
2. Retrovibe
3. Gristle King
4. Eureka
5. Lucydreamer
6. Send/Return loop to place different pedals in
7. Boomster
8. Waterfall
9. Harmonious Monk
10. Delay Llama mk.2
11. Delay Llama XTREME
